On Fri, 30 Nov 2001 [EMAIL PROTECTED] wrote: > Je viens de faire une mise à jour d'une Debian Patate, à partir des > cdrom fournis par Marc. En plus, j'ai ajouté KDE. Il y a eu quelques
En suivant /KDE-INSTALL ? Ce n'est pas tout à fait trivial. En particulier il ne faut laisser `optional' que si l'on a lu les indications (indications dont je parle sur la feuille d'update). Cela pourrait expliquer tes déboires avec Apache. NB: dès la version 18 du CD KDE j'ai ajouté un répertoire DEBIAN_UPDATE avec les updates 2.2r4. > Un petit problème avec le serveur X: Il démarre automatiquement après le > boot, et j'aimerais pouvoir le faire démarrer manuellement un tapant # update-rc.d -f kdm remove (remplacer kdm par xdm si c'est xdm). (cela ne fait rien de magique, cela enlève les liens symboliques des rc-scripts dans /etc/init.d) NB: sur un serveur je déconseille en général de tourner X11, a fortiori KDE. KDE ouvre des ports pour son CORBA qu'il faut soit fermer soit firewaller. > Quelqu'un pourrait-il me faire comment j'indique au serveur apache qu'il > doit reconnaître les scripts perl et python? En général je ne fais pas ici. Je crée un répertoire cgi-bin pour l'utilisateur (dans ~/public_html), j'active le suexec, et j'indique que ce répertoire contient des exécutables. Ainsi: Ainsi: - les scripts en dehors ne sont pas exécutables, c'est plus sûr - les seuls scripts exécutables s'exécutent avec l'UID de la personne concernée (ce qui permet p.ex. de mettre le mot de passe de bases de données dans un fichier dans ~/perl-libs, répertoire 0700 de l'utilisateur) Exemple: access.conf: <Directory /home/schaefer/public_html/cgi-bin> AllowOverride AuthConfig Options ExecCGI SymLinksIfOwnerMatch </Directory> srm.conf: ScriptAlias /~schaefer/cgi-bin/ /home/schaefer/public_html/cgi-bin/ Ne pas oublier de vérifier que le suexec est fonctionnel. > Le butineur "konqueror" n'est pas mal, mais il y a deux détails que je > voudrais pouvoir modifier: > > - Si j'inscris le nom d'un site web dans la barre d'adresses sans > inscrire http:// au début, ça ne marche pas. Netscape rajoute ça > automatiquement, Konqueror pas. On peut corriger ce détail? Le problème est que c'est incorrect. Le `préfixe' http:// est *obligatoire* selon les standards (comme la spécification entière du domaine et le / final; WWW n'est pas minitel, n'en déplaise aux clients WWW qui supposent que `truc' signifie forcément http://www.truc.com/). Maintenant, la raison que Konqueror n'a pas comme les autres ignoré ces standards c'est que Konqueror est aussi un gestionnaire de fichier. Exemple: ALT-F2, tu tapes: xterm -> lance un xterm man:passwd(5) -> page de manuel chapitre 5 (formats de fichier) pour le fichier passwd /usr -> gestionnaire de fichiers sur /usr http://www.truc.ch/ -> URL du WWW. Maintenant, la barre dont tu parles a toutes ces fonctionnalités, sauf la première (l'exécution). Donc, en théorie, dans ce cas, Konqueror pourrait deviner que si le texte ne commence pas par un / c'est forcément un URL. Sauf dans le cas où tu veux accéder relativement à un de tes répertoires: là tu ne mets pas de /. C'est donc impossible de discriminer nom de fichier/répertoire d'URL. Le préfixe http:// ne peut donc pas être enlevé. C'est une bonne habitude à prendre de le spécifier systématiquement. -- http://www-internal.alphanet.ch/linux-leman/ avant de poser une question. Ouais, pour se désabonner aussi.